Quickly control the brightness levels of your display. Includes simple step-based controls and precise Lunar-based commands.
Increase or decrease the brightness by one system step (~10%) using simulated keyboard shortcuts. Works out of the box with no extra dependencies.
Set the brightness of your display to an exact level (1-100) directly from the search bar using Lunar. Automatically detects the display where your cursor is located.
Instantly set brightness to 100% on the display where your cursor is located. Uses Lunar under the hood.
The Brightness Up and Brightness Down commands work without any additional setup.
The Set Brightness and Max Brightness commands require Lunar (free for basic brightness control). The extension will automatically install Lunar and its CLI on first use via Homebrew. If auto-install fails, you'll get actionable prompts to open the Lunar website or copy the install command.
